GC
|
GC ( seq )
calculates G+C content
|
|
GC123
|
GC123 ( seq )
calculates totla G+C content plus first, second and third position
|
|
GC_Frame
|
GC_Frame ( seq, genetic_code=1 )
just an alias for six_frame_translations
|
|
GC_skew
|
GC_skew ( seq, window=100 )
calculates GC skew (G-C)/(G+C)
|
|
antiparallel
|
antiparallel ( seq )
returns reversed complementary sequence ( = other strand )

nt_search
|
nt_search ( seq, subseq )
search for a DNA subseq in sequence
use ambiguous values (like N = A or T or C or G, R = A or G etc.)
searches only on forward strand
